Shelter & settlement planning in emergencies helps you understand strategies and practices that are intrinsic to the shelter sector and humanitarian sector in general. The training aims to improve the effectiveness of specialist and non – specialist in emergency response. This training aims to equip participants with the skills required to design a shelter and settlements response in a humanitarian crisis after natural disasters. It will provide participants with an overview of shelter and settlements in emergencies, their relevance in humanitarian programmes and an understanding of the principles and practice of humanitarian shelter response.

Target audience

The training will target Individuals working in the humanitarian and shelter sectors for the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ement, United Nations agencies or Non-Governmental Organizations, or Governments, particularly agencies or institutions actively involved in the delivery of humanitarian assistance through shelter and settlements responses at global or country level.

Course Objectives

By the end of training the participant should be able to:

  • Understand the range of possible impacts of settlement and shelter upon local, national and regional security.
  • Be in position to understand the range of transitional settlement options available for support.
  • Understand the mechanisms and phases of coordination and response.

Course Content

  • The Humanitarian Reform, the cluster approach, and the shelter cluster
  • IFRC mechanisms for emergency response
  • IFRC Emergency finance tools: DREFT and appeals (PEA, EA, REA)
  • Principles of shelter after disaster (emergency and recovery)
  • Difference between relief and recovery, how shelter programmes bridge them.
  • Settlements options for displaced and non-displaced population before and after a disaster
  • Needs/damages/capacities assessments for shelter and settlements programmes
  • Implementation emergency shelter response: logistic, relief/distribution and technical support
  • Shelter and settlements programming aspects related with settlements options, site planning, living space, design, construction, and environment (shelter chapter, Sphere standards)
  • Planning shelter response: drafting a plan of action, targeting and selection of beneficiaries, monitoring and evaluation of the programme.
